

Fly on the Wall with Dana Carvey and David Spade
Audacy
Longtime pals David Spade and Dana Carvey take you behind the curtain of showbiz as they hang out and chat with friends (old and new) from all corners of the entertainment world. Be a “Fly on the Wall” every Thursday as the guys and their guests share stories, tell jokes, do impressions, and deep dive into the comedy mind. On Mondays, join Dana and David to riff on current events, pop culture, trending clips, and answer audience questions. Mike Myers and Paul Myers Talk Beatles and John Candy!
Join iconic actor Mike Myers, known for his roles in 'Wayne's World' and 'Austin Powers,' alongside his brother Paul Myers, an author and podcaster who penned 'John Candy: A Life in Comedy.' They dive into heartfelt memories of John Candy, share insights from Paul's biography, and explore why Canadian comedians thrive. The conversation shifts to a deep admiration for the Beatles, discussing everything from McCartney's melodies to the nuanced drumming of Ringo Starr, all while serving up a delightful dose of sibling stories and fond reminiscences.

RE-RELEASE - Andy Samberg
Andy Samberg, a comedic powerhouse and SNL alum, shares insights from his groundbreaking career. He discusses the transition from SNL to sitcoms, revealing his initial hesitations and writing challenges. The rise of digital shorts, particularly 'Lazy Sunday', reshaped SNL's legacy and paved the way for YouTube fame. With anecdotes about collaboration with icons like Adam Sandler and memorable sketches, Andy provides a peek into the creative process behind cult classics. He also touches on balancing family life while keeping his comedic edge.
